On this day, we mourn the loss of one of Dead by Daylight’s most iconic survivor setups – the vault build is officially no more. Out of respect, we gave this glorious build one more run before it was nerfed. Combining some of the strongest chase perks in the game – Resilience (the only one not nerfed), Spine Chill, Dead Hard, and Decisive Strike – we have what was once possibly the most powerful survivor setup in the game. As of the day this video was posted, most of these perks have been gutted making them FAR less effective. So let’s give the vault build one more run, and remind ourselves of it’s former glory.
